01 Feb Online Sales Skyrocketed This Holiday—Will Amazon's Profit Follow?
The company’s investment-heavy strategy could force a Q4 earnings miss tomorrow, even as it continues to crush traditional retailers.

It’s been a heck of a holiday quarter for Amazon, what with online sales at record levels and the e-commerce giant entrenching itself further into the supply chain with ventures like Prime Air—not to mention more aggressive bets on original movies and TV content. When Amazon reports fourth-quarter earnings tomorrow afternoon, there will almost be too many moving parts to keep track of, but we’ll have our eye on a few key things. Specifically, are customers actually grafting on to its new services? And are some of these bets finally paying off?
